Asturian

Etymology

From Latin assistere, present active infinitive of assistō.

Verb

asistir (first-person singular indicative present asisto, past participle asistíu)

  1. to happen
  2. to attend
  3. to help, assist, help out

Spanish

Etymology

From Latin assistere, present active infinitive of assistō.

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/asisˈtiɾ/ [a.sisˈt̪iɾ]

Verb
